RALEIGH, North Carolina, Feb. 10 -- The Environmental Working Group issued the following news release on Feb. 9, 2024:
Lawyers for monopoly power company Duke Energy were on defense at a February 7 hearing before the North Carolina Court of Appeals over state regulators' decision last year, at the utility's behest, to slash financial incentives for residents seeking to adopt rooftop solar.
